You don't have to decide everything today.

Many families tell us they avoid preplanning because it feels overwhelming. All those choices. All those details.

But here's what we tell them: you don't need to plan the whole service in one sitting.

Just start with one decision. Burial or cremation. That's it.

Once you make that choice, everything else gets easier. The options narrow. The path clears. And you can take your time with the rest.

Preplanning isn't about having all the answers right now. It's about lifting one weight off your family's shoulders before they ever have to carry it.
